To start manipulating article categories, go to " Pages -> List of Categories ".
The output of articles (contacts, work schedule) or categories (blog, news) in the site header at the top, in the bottom block and in the mobile version of the site is carried out in the module " Modules -> All modules -> Menu ".

Settings tab
1. Language switcher for category translation (if the site uses more than 1 language)
2. Category name (translated field)
3. Link on which the category will be available (generated automatically from the name)
4. The category to which the created or edited category will belong (you can leave it empty so that the category is the main one)
5. Field groups for categories from " Pages -> Field Builder " (for developers, it allows you to expand the list of fields for expansion and binding in the template without interfering with the database)
6. Apply the data from point 5 for all child categories
7. Groups of fields for pages that will be in this category from " Pages -> Field Builder " (for developers, it makes it possible to expand the list of fields for extension and binding in the template without interfering with the base)
8. Apply data from point 7 for all child categories
9. Description of the category (translated field, displayed in a different place, depending on the template)
10. Sort type (by which parameter the articles in the category will be sorted)
11. Sorting method
12. The number of articles on one page (the rest will be displayed with the ability to switch pages)
13. Ability to set pages that are in this category, the ability to comment by default
14. Ability to display pages from other categories without changing the link in the articles themselves
15. Fields for developers, which make it possible to use another template file to display an article or category, to change the view (leave the fields blank for the user)
Category meta data is translatable (if the site uses more than 1 language) and is not filled in by itself (as in articles).
Additional fields tab
The tab is for developers. The fields from this tab are not bound in the template in article categories and are designed to facilitate expansion without interfering with the database. New fields can be created in " Pages -> Field Builder ", but they will not be used in the template.
Removal of categories of articles is made from the list of categories. Deleting a main category deletes all of its children. When categories are deleted, articles are also deleted.
